Statistics

The Statistics tab shows a visual summary of collected responses. Charts appear for multiple choice questions, for matrix checkbox, matrix yes/no, and matrix number questions, and for Multi-Part questions other than Multi-Part Text. Other question types are not shown.

Statistics are always shown for a specific publication, selected from the dropdown at the top of the page. A badge below the selector shows the total number of responses included.

The same filters available on the Responses tab apply here: date range and completion status.

Each question is shown as a card containing its title (stripped of HTML formatting), the total responses received, and a chart of the answer distribution. Questions with no responses still appear, with a zero count.

For multiple choice questions, each card has a chart type selector:

TypeDescription
Bar chartVertical bars, one per answer option, showing response counts.
Horizontal barHorizontal bars, useful when answer option labels are long.
Pie chartA proportional pie chart showing the share of each answer option.

Charts show tooltips with the count and percentage for each option. The selected chart type is saved per question and shared with other administrators.

Matrix checkbox, matrix yes/no, and matrix number questions each get one card with a grouped bar chart: one series per subquestion, grouped by answer option (or the reverse, depending on the question’s row/column orientation). Checkbox and yes/no bars show the percentage of responses with that cell selected; number bars show the average value entered. A table below the chart lists the exact figure for each pair. No chart type selector is available.

Each part of a Multi-Part question is charted as if it were its own standalone question of the part’s answer type. Multi-Part Yes/No, Stars, 5-Point, and 10-Point questions show one grouped bar chart with one series per part, alongside the percentage share for each option. Multi-Part Number shows one bar per part with the average value entered. Multi-Part Text has no chart, matching standalone Text questions. No chart type selector is available.

Question titles and answer option labels appear in the language selected in the editor, falling back to the default language where no translation exists.
